我的编程空间,编程开发者的网络收藏夹
学习永远不晚

数据结构复习

短信预约 -IT技能 免费直播动态提醒
省份

北京

  • 北京
  • 上海
  • 天津
  • 重庆
  • 河北
  • 山东
  • 辽宁
  • 黑龙江
  • 吉林
  • 甘肃
  • 青海
  • 河南
  • 江苏
  • 湖北
  • 湖南
  • 江西
  • 浙江
  • 广东
  • 云南
  • 福建
  • 海南
  • 山西
  • 四川
  • 陕西
  • 贵州
  • 安徽
  • 广西
  • 内蒙
  • 西藏
  • 新疆
  • 宁夏
  • 兵团
手机号立即预约

请填写图片验证码后获取短信验证码

看不清楚,换张图片

免费获取短信验证码

数据结构复习

  1. 什么是数据结构?数据结构是抽象数据类型的物理实现
  2. 抽象数据结构,怎么理解抽象
    数据结构

抽象数据类型:对数据类型的描述,这种描述是抽象的,描述1.数据对象集,2.与数据集合关联的操作集

抽象:不依赖于具体实现,只描述是什么,不涉及如何做到
数据对象类型的抽象:elementtype
对数据对象的描述不涉及具体的存储方式
对操作的描述不涉及具体的实现

抽象数据类型:数组,矩阵,队列,栈,树(特别:二叉树),图

  1. 数据对象在计算机中的组织方式
    逻辑结构
    物理结构:顺序存储,链式存储

  2. 程序与算法 算法是有限指令集合 ,一定要在有限步骤内终止
    程序等于数据加算法,程序可以无限运行
    进程是程序在不同数据集合上运行的实体

算法复杂度
衡量算法质量的方式
算法时间复杂度
算法空间复杂度

最坏情况复杂度
平均复杂度

渐进表示法分析算法复杂度的增长趋势

来源地址:https://blog.csdn.net/m0_51312071/article/details/132574689

免责声明:

① 本站未注明“稿件来源”的信息均来自网络整理。其文字、图片和音视频稿件的所属权归原作者所有。本站收集整理出于非商业性的教育和科研之目的,并不意味着本站赞同其观点或证实其内容的真实性。仅作为临时的测试数据,供内部测试之用。本站并未授权任何人以任何方式主动获取本站任何信息。

② 本站未注明“稿件来源”的临时测试数据将在测试完成后最终做删除处理。有问题或投稿请发送至: 邮箱/279061341@qq.com QQ/279061341

数据结构复习

下载Word文档到电脑,方便收藏和打印~

下载Word文档

猜你喜欢

数据结构复习

什么是数据结构?数据结构是抽象数据类型的物理实现抽象数据结构,怎么理解抽象 数据结构 抽象数据类型:对数据类型的描述,这种描述是抽象的,描述1.数据对象集,2.与数据集合关联的操作集 抽象:不依赖于具体实现,只描述是什么,不涉及如何做到 数
2023-08-30

PHP学习笔记:数据结构与算法

概述:数据结构和算法是计算机科学中非常重要的两个概念,它们是解决问题和优化代码性能的关键。在PHP编程中,我们常常需要使用各种数据结构来存储和操作数据,同时也需要使用算法来实现各种功能。本文将介绍一些常用的数据结构和算法,并提供相应的PHP
2023-10-21

python学习3-内置数据结构3-by

一、字符串与bytesstr是文本系列,有编码,bytes是字节系列,没有编码,文本的编码是字符如何用字节来表示。都不可变,python3默认使用utf8。文本转换编码:s.encode(['编码方式'])编码转换文本:s.decode([
2023-01-31

Python学习之day3数据结构之列表

数据结构之列表一、列表定义      列表是处理一组有序项目的数据结构,即你可以在一个列表中存储一个序列的项目。列表中的项目应包括在方括号中,这样python就是知道你是指名了一个列表。一旦你创建了一个列表,你可以添加、删除或者搜索列表中的
2023-01-31

oracle怎么复制表结构及数据

Oracle数据库中,可以使用以下两种方式复制表结构及数据:使用CREATE TABLE AS SELECT语句:这种方法可以复制表结构并将数据插入到新表中。语法如下:CREATE TABLE new_table AS SELECT * F
oracle怎么复制表结构及数据
2024-04-09

python数据结构

一:数据结构  数据结构可以认为他们是用来处理一些数据的或者说是存储数据。  对于数据结构的介绍会关系到类和对象的定义,此处对这两个定义加以描述。  何为类:说道类首先我们能够想到类型,在数据结构中类型有哪些常用的类型有int整型,floa
2023-01-31

python学习3-内置数据结构2-元组

元组是不可变的,可hash1、定义t = tuple()t = (1,2,3)2、查t[index] #按照下标获取值t.index(value) #按照值获取下标值,不存在报value errott.count(value) #获取某个值
2023-01-31

python学习3-内置数据结构1-列表

列表及常用操作    列表是一个序列,用于顺序的存储数据1、定义与初始化lst = list() #使用list函数定义空列表lst = []    #使用中括号定义列表lst = [1,2,3]    #使用中括号定义初始值列表lst =
2023-01-31

python学习3-内置数据结构3-字符

字符串是集合类型1、定义s = 'hello python's = "hellp python"以上2种没有区别s = '''hello python'''s = """hello python"""以上2种没有区别区别在于三引号可以定义多
2023-01-31

oracle怎么复制表结构和数据

在Oracle数据库中,可以使用以下两种方法来复制表的结构和数据:使用CREATE TABLE AS SELECT语句:这是最简单的一种方法,可以通过执行以下语句来复制表的结构和数据:CREATE TABLE new_table AS SE
oracle怎么复制表结构和数据
2024-04-09

编程热搜

目录